CentOS系统因其稳定性和安全性而广受欢迎,但在使用过程中也需要进行适当的安全设置以防范潜在威胁。以下是一些CentOS系统应急响应方法以及Python安全设置的要点:
CentOS系统应急响应方法
- 关闭不必要的服务:例如,通过
service iptables stop
和 chkconfig iptables off
命令关闭iptables服务,以减少潜在的网络攻击面。
- 禁用Ctrl+Alt+Delete:修改
/etc/inittab
文件,注释掉与Ctrl+Alt+Delete相关的行,以防止用户通过该组合键重启系统。
Python安全设置要点
- 使用安全的库和工具:在Python框架开发中,应使用安全的库和工具,如Flask-Security来管理Web应用的安全性,使用SQLAlchemy等ORM工具进行数据库操作以避免SQL注入攻击。
- 数据验证和转义:对用户输入的数据进行严格的验证,确保其符合预期格式,避免注入攻击。在将用户输入渲染到HTML模板中之前,对其进行适当的过滤和转义,防止跨站脚本攻击(XSS)。
- 安全配置和部署:使用环境变量或配置文件存储敏感数据,如数据库连接信息、API密钥等,并确保这些信息在存储和传输过程中加密。在生产环境中,使用HTTPS协议来保护数据传输过程的安全。
通过上述措施,可以显著提高CentOS系统的安全性,保护系统免受潜在威胁。